use webcore::try_from::{
TryFrom,
TryInto,
};
use webcore::value::{
ConversionError,
Reference,
Value,
};
#[derive(Copy, Clone, Debug, Eq, PartialEq)]
pub enum GamepadMappingType {
NoMapping,
Standard,
}
impl TryFrom<Value> for GamepadMappingType {
type Error = ConversionError;
fn try_from(v: Value) -> Result<Self, Self::Error> {
let value: String = v.try_into()?;
match value.as_ref() {
"" => Ok(GamepadMappingType::NoMapping),
"standard" => Ok(GamepadMappingType::Standard),
s => Err(ConversionError::Custom(format!("invalid gamepad mapping type \"{}\"", s))),
}
}
}
#[derive(Clone, Debug, Eq, PartialEq, ReferenceType)]
#[reference(instance_of = "GamepadButton")]
pub struct GamepadButton( Reference );
impl GamepadButton {
#[inline]
pub fn pressed(&self) -> bool {
js!(
return @{self.as_ref()}.pressed;
).try_into().unwrap()
}
#[inline]
pub fn touched(&self) -> bool {
js!(
return @{self.as_ref()}.touched;
).try_into().unwrap()
}
#[inline]
pub fn value(&self) -> f64 {
js!(
return @{self.as_ref()}.value;
).try_into().unwrap()
}
}
#[derive(Clone, Debug, Eq, PartialEq, ReferenceType)]
#[reference(instance_of = "Gamepad")]
pub struct Gamepad( Reference );
impl Gamepad {
#[inline]
pub fn id(&self) -> String {
js!(
return @{self.as_ref()}.id;
).try_into().unwrap()
}
#[inline]
pub fn index(&self) -> i32 {
js!(
return @{self.as_ref()}.index;
).try_into().unwrap()
}
#[inline]
pub fn connected(&self) -> bool {
js!(
return @{self.as_ref()}.connected;
).try_into().unwrap()
}
#[inline]
pub fn timestamp(&self) -> f64 {
js!(
return @{self.as_ref()}.timestamp;
).try_into().unwrap()
}
#[inline]
pub fn mapping(&self) -> GamepadMappingType {
js!(
return @{self.as_ref()}.mapping;
).try_into().unwrap()
}
#[inline]
pub fn axes(&self) -> Vec<f64> {
js!(
return @{self.as_ref()}.axes;
).try_into().unwrap()
}
#[inline]
pub fn buttons(&self) -> Vec<GamepadButton> {
js!(
return @{self.as_ref()}.buttons;
).try_into().unwrap()
}
pub fn get_all() -> Vec<Option<Gamepad>> {
js!(
return Array.from(navigator.getGamepads());
).try_into().unwrap()
}
}
#[cfg(test)]
mod tests {
use super::GamepadMappingType;
use webcore::try_from::TryInto;
use webcore::value::{ConversionError, Value};
#[test]
fn test_value_into_gamepad_mapping() {
let to_mapping = |v: Value| -> Result<GamepadMappingType, ConversionError> {
v.try_into()
};
assert_eq!(to_mapping("standard".into()), Ok(GamepadMappingType::Standard));
assert_eq!(to_mapping("".into()), Ok(GamepadMappingType::NoMapping));
assert!(to_mapping("fakemapping".into()).is_err());
assert!(to_mapping(Value::Null).is_err());
}
}
